La factorización es una herramienta elemental en las matemáticas. Mediante este proceso, se reescribe una expresión compleja como el producto de varios factores más simples. Esta técnica no solo simplifica el análisis y la resolución de ecuaciones, sino que también abre la puerta a la comprensión de diversas propiedades inherentes a los polinomios y funciones matemáticas. La habilidad para factorizar es crucial para estudiantes, ingenieros, científicos y profesionales de la informática, dado que permite abordar problemas de una manera estructurada y menos propensa a error.
En el contexto de las ecuaciones, la factorización ayuda a transformar una ecuación aparentemente intrincada en un conjunto de multiplicaciones más manejables. Este proceso es especialmente evidente en las ecuaciones cuadráticas y polinómicas, en las que la detección inmediata de raíces se vuelve esencial para el análisis, estimación y resolución. Por ejemplo, al factorizar la ecuación \( \text{\(\(x^2 + 5x + 6 = 0\)\)} \) como \((x+2)(x+3)=0\), se puede identificar al instante que \(x=-2\) o \(x=-3\) son las raíces de la ecuación.
En matemáticas, la factorización consiste en expresar una expresión algebraica en forma de productos de factores. A nivel elemental, esta técnica se utiliza para:
El proceso se fundamenta en propiedades como la propiedad distributiva y las identidades notables, las cuales permiten reconocer patrones en las expresiones y reescribirlas de forma productoria. Además, el concepto de factorización se extiende a la descomposición en factores primos en el ámbito de la teoría de números, lo cual es vital para algoritmos en criptografía y seguridad informática.
En este método, se detecta de forma inmediata un patrón en la expresión. Por ejemplo, en una ecuación cuadrática de la forma \( \text{\(\(x^2 + bx + c\)\)} \), se buscan dos números cuya suma sea igual a \(b\) y cuyo producto sea \(c\). Una vez identificados estos números, la factorización se realiza formando dos binomios.
Muchas expresiones se pueden factorizar aplicando identidades tales como:
Para polinomios que contienen más de tres términos, se utiliza la agrupación. Esto consiste en organizar términos de manera que se forme un factor común en cada grupo. Una vez extraídos estos factores, se puede sintetizar la expresión en productos; técnica particularmente útil en ecuaciones de tercer y cuarto grado.
En áreas como la criptografía, algoritmos como Pollard-Rho permiten la factorización de grandes números compuestos. Estos algoritmos son esenciales para romper ciertos esquemas de cifrado, especialmente en métodos asimétricos como el RSA, en el cual la seguridad depende de la dificultad de factorizar números muy grandes.
Una de las aplicaciones directas de la factorización es la resolución de ecuaciones cuadráticas y polinómicas. Por ejemplo, al factorizador la ecuación \( \text{\(\(x^2 - 5x + 6 = 0\)\)} \) se identifica:
\[ \text{\(\(x^2 - 5x + 6 = (x-2)(x-3) = 0\)\)} \]
Esto implica que los valores \(x=2\) y \(x=3\) satisfacen la ecuación, lo cual demuestra cómo la factorización facilita la búsqueda de soluciones. Esta metodología es aplicable tanto en expresiones simples como en polinomios de orden superior, permitiendo resolver sistemas complejos y a la vez detectar comportamientos en las funciones algebraicas.
En el análisis matemático y el cálculo, la factorización juega un papel fundamental al facilitar la identificación de raíces y puntos críticos en funciones algebraicas y racionales. Por ejemplo:
Al descomponer el numerador y denominador de una función racional, se pueden identificar valores que dan lugar a asíntotas, discontinuidades o huecos en la gráfica. Esta información es crucial al estudiar la continuidad y el comportamiento asintótico de la función, así como en la determinación de intervalos de crecimiento y decrecimiento.
La factorización no solo se limita a la resolución de ecuaciones puramente matemáticas, sino que también tiene aplicaciones prácticas en diferentes campos científicos:
Una aplicación muy relevante de la factorización en el ámbito de la seguridad viene de la teoría de números. La factorización de números enteros, en particular la descomposición en factores primos, es la base del cifrado RSA. En este sistema, la dificultad de factorizar un número compuesto en sus factores primos garantiza la robustez del cifrado y protege la información. Los avances en algoritmos de factorización tienen implicaciones directas en la seguridad, ya que una factorización rápida y eficiente podría vulnerar sistemas que dependen de la complejidad computacional.
Considere la ecuación \( \text{\(\(x^2 + 5x + 6 = 0\)\)} \). Utilizando la técnica de factorización, se puede reescribir como:
\[ \text{\(\(x^2 + 5x + 6 = (x+2)(x+3)\)\)} \]
Esto conduce a las soluciones:
\[ \text{\(\(x+2=0 \Rightarrow x=-2,\quad x+3=0 \Rightarrow x=-3\)\)} \]
En este caso, la factorización permite pasar de un problema de resolución directa a la identificación de raíces con precisión y rapidez.
Para ilustrar un problema aplicado, considere un rectángulo cuyo área es de 40 unidades cuadradas y cuya longitud es 3 unidades mayor que el ancho. Sea \(w\) el ancho; su longitud será \(w+3\). Entonces, la ecuación es:
\[ \text{\(\(w(w+3)=40\)\)} \]
Al expandir y reordenar la ecuación:
\[ \text{\(\(w^2 + 3w - 40=0\)\)} \]
La factorización de esta ecuación lleva a:
\[ \text{\(\( (w-5)(w+8)=0\)\)} \]
lo que implica \(w=5\) (descartando \(w=-8\) por no tener sentido físico en este contexto). De esta manera, se determina que el ancho es de 5 unidades y la longitud, 8 unidades, demostrando la aplicación de la factorización en problemas de modelado de situaciones reales.
La factorización también es crucial para analizar funciones racionales. Considere una función dada por:
\[ \text{\(\(f(x)=\frac{x^2-16}{x^2-4x}\)\)} \]
Factorizando tanto el numerador como el denominador:
\[ \text{\(\(x^2-16=(x-4)(x+4) \quad \text{y} \quad x^2-4x=x(x-4)\)\)} \]
Se simplifica la función cancelando el factor común \((x-4)\) (notando que \(x \neq 4\)), resultando en:
\[ \text{\(\(f(x)=\frac{x+4}{x}\)\)} \]
Este análisis resulta esencial para identificar el dominio de la función, asíntotas y otros comportamientos relevantes en la gráfica de la función.
| Área | Aplicación | Ejemplo |
|---|---|---|
| Álgebra | Resolución de ecuaciones cuadráticas y polinómicas | \(x^2 + 5x + 6 = (x+2)(x+3)=0\) |
| Análisis de Funciones | Detección de raíces, asintotas y discontinuidades | Factorización de \(\frac{x^2-16}{x^2-4x}\) a \(\frac{x+4}{x}\) |
| Física | Modelado de trayectorias y puntos de intersección | Ecuaciones de movimiento de proyectiles |
| Ingeniería | Análisis de sistemas de ecuaciones y estabilidad | Descomposición de matrices |
| Criptografía | Factorización de grandes números para seguridad | Cifrado RSA |
Con el avance de la computación, se ha desarrollado una amplia gama de algoritmos de factorización, los cuales han sido implementados en diversos software y sistemas. Estos algoritmos permiten descomponer números compuestos o polinomios en sus factores constituyentes de manera rápida y eficiente. Un ejemplo notable es el algoritmo Pollard-Rho, empleado en escenarios de criptografía para factorizar números grandes cuya complejidad constituye la base de la seguridad en esquemas criptográficos.
Los avances en este campo han permitido que la factorización no solo sea una herramienta pedagógica en matemáticas, sino también un componente esencial en el análisis y la resolución de problemas prácticos en ciencia e ingeniería. La capacidad para factorizar grandes números de forma computacional ha generado un impacto significativo en áreas como la teoría de números, la encriptación y análisis de señales.
Los métodos de factorizar han sido implementados en numerosos lenguajes de programación; estos pueden ser utilizados para resolver automáticamente ecuaciones y verificar teoremas matemáticos. A continuación, se muestra un ejemplo de código en Python, con comentarios que explican el proceso básico de factorización de una ecuación cuadrática:
# Función para factorizar una ecuación cuadrática ax^2 + bx + c = 0
def factorizar_cuadratica(a, b, c):
# Calcular el discriminante
discriminante = b<b>2 - 4*a*c
if discriminante < 0:
return "No hay raíces reales."
# Cálculo de las raíces
raiz1 = (-b + discriminante</b>0.5) / (2*a)
raiz2 = (-b - discriminante**0.5) / (2*a)
return (raiz1, raiz2)
# Ejemplo: Resolver x^2 + 5x + 6 = 0
resultado = factorizar_cuadratica(1, 5, 6)
print("Las raíces son:", resultado)
Este ejemplo ilustra cómo se puede automatizar el proceso de resolución de una ecuación cuadrática, facilitando la detección de soluciones de forma programática.
La factorización constituye una técnica transversal y vital para diversas áreas. La capacidad de descomponer expresiones no solo simplifica la resolución de ecuaciones matemáticas, sino que también influye en la forma en que se modelan y resuelven problemas en la física, ingeniería, economía y tecnología digital. Este proceso es una de las piedras angulares en el análisis matemático avanzado.
Las aplicaciones en el campo del análisis de funciones permiten identificar comportamientos críticos en funciones racionales y polinómicas, facilitando el estudio de continuidad, derivadas y tasas de cambio. En ingeniería, esta técnica se usa frecuentemente en el cálculo de tensiones en estructuras, en la descomposición de señales y en el análisis de sistemas dinámicos.
Con el continuo avance de los algoritmos y la capacidad computacional, se espera que la factorización y sus métodos derivados ganen aún mayor importancia en el análisis de datos, la encriptación y la resolución automatizada de problemas matemáticos complejos. La integración de estos algoritmos en programas de inteligencia artificial y en sistemas de procesamiento de lenguaje natural abre nuevas perspectivas para abordar problemas complejos a través de modelos matemáticos precisos y eficientes.
Además, la colaboración entre matemáticos, científicos de la computación e ingenieros continúa ampliando la aplicabilidad de la factorización, probando ser un puente crítico entre la teoría y la práctica en un mundo cada vez más digital y basado en datos.